Two bedroom mid terrace house located within 650 metres of Hatfield Train Station. The property has been fully refurnished and comprises lounge, kitchen, bathroom, gas central heating, double glazed, rear garden and allocated parking.
Ground Floor -
Kitchen - 3.58m x 2.74m - Range of wall and base units, work surfaces, single drainer bowel sink with mixer tap, tiled splash back, tiled floor, integrated fridge/freezer, Hoover washing machine, Beko electric oven and hob with extractor fan above, cupboard housing Baxi boiler, radiator, double glazed window to rear, double glazed patio doors to rear garden.
Lounge - 4.7m x 3.58m - Radiator, cupboard housing consumer unit, under stairs cupboard, double glazed window to front, turn flight stairs leading to:
First Floor -
Bedroom One - 3.58m x 2.77m - Radiator, wardrobe, double glazed window to rear.
Bedroom Two - 3.58m x 2.18m - Radiator, double glazed window to front.
Bathroom - 2.64m x 1.37m - White three piece suite comprising paneled bath with mixer tap, wall mounted Thermostatic shower and shower screen, low level wc, vanitry unit with mixer tap, heating towel rail, cupboard housing water tank, high level storage cupboard, extractor fan.
Landing - Access to loft void.
Exterior -
Rear Garden - 13.72m - Lawn area, patio area.
Front Garden - Path to front door, small lawn area.
Agent Notes - Holding Deposit - £380
Dilapidations Deposit - £1,903
Tenancy Term - Monthly Periodic Tenancy
EPC Rating - C
Council Tax Band D - Welwyn & Hatfield Council
